Description

The New Jersey Society of Certified Public Accountants (NJSCPA) is a non-profit, professional business organization, comprised of more than 14,500 Certified Public Accountants. Founded in 1898, the NJSCPA is one of the largest and oldest state CPA societies in the nation.

The NJSCPA was founded in Newark by four accountants who worked in public practice to secure a solid position for their profession and to increase public awareness about the value provided by CPAs. Today, the increasingly diverse membership consists of CPAs who work in business and industry, in government, education, and at accounting firms ranging in size from sole practitioners to large international organizations.

From its administrative headquarters in Roseland, the NJSCPA provides members with a broad range of opportunities for their volunteer involvement and professional development. There are 11 chapters throughout the state and 39 statewide committees focusing on areas ranging from accounting, taxes and legislation to sports and entertainment, human resources and community affairs.
